"If I proclaimed that the most exciting red wines in the United States come from New York State, would you believe me?" writes Wine Enthusiast's Anna Lee C. Iijima."On Long Island, classic Bordeaux varieties like Merlot, Cabernet Franc and Cabernet Sauvignon have flourished since their first plantings in the early 1970s. And in the Finger Lakes, where Riesling was long considered the only viable Vitis vinifera variety, Cabernet Franc, Pinot Noir and other reds are gaining momentum." Read more of her review here.
